The Essence of Indian Flavors



The vivid tapestry of Indian food is delicately woven with a varied variety of flavors. Each flavor contributes unique tastes and fragrances that define the culinary landscape of India. Cumin, cardamom, turmeric extract, and coriander are just a couple of examples of the crucial active ingredients that play a critical duty in boosting vegan recipes. These spices not just add deepness to the food yet additionally give countless wellness benefits, such as antioxidant and anti-inflammatory residential or commercial properties.




The art of blending flavors, referred to as "masala," is a characteristic of Indian cooking. Chefs commonly develop their very own mixes, customizing flavors to individual tastes and local choices. This complexity enriches the dining experience, permitting for a multitude of tastes in a single recipe. Because of this, Indian vegan food transcends plain food, providing a vibrant exploration of taste and society that mesmerizes the senses and nurtures the soul.

South Indian Delicacies



Rich in tastes and structures, South Indian specials display a variety of regional ranges that captivate the taste. The culinary landscape is noted by recipes such as dosa, a slim fermented crepe made from rice and lentils, frequently offered with sambar and coconut chutney. Idli, steamed rice cakes, supply a soft, cosy counterpart, while uttapam, a thick pancake covered with vegetables, provides a passionate option. Using seasonings like mustard seeds, curry fallen leaves, and dried out red chilies enhances the meals' deepness. In addition, the coastal areas contribute fish and shellfish prep work, integrating coconut and tamarind for a distinctive taste. Generally, South Indian vegetarian cuisine mirrors an abundant custom, stabilizing health and taste in every dish.

Popular Indian Vegetarian Recipes



Discovering the varied landscape of Indian vegetarian dishes discloses a lively range of tastes and active ingredients that satisfy various preferences and preferences. Among the most prominent meals is Paneer Tikka, marinated dices of paneer grilled to excellence, commonly gone along with by mint chutney. Another fave is Chole Bhature, a hearty chickpea curry offered with deep-fried bread, ideal for pleasing hunger. The traditional Aloo Gobi, a spiced combination of potatoes and cauliflower, showcases the beauty of simple ingredients. Dal Makhani, an abundant lentil dish prepared with butter and lotion, provides a comforting experience. For a lighter alternative, the stimulating Palak Paneer, featuring spinach and paneer in a delicious gravy, is a staple. Ultimately, Biryani, commonly made with fragrant basmati rice and various vegetables, supplies a cheery style to any kind of meal. These dishes not only highlight the culinary variety of India their website however also commemorate the splendor of vegetarian cuisine.

Strategies of Indian Cooking



Indian vegan cuisine is defined not only by its lively components yet also by the methods that bring these flavors to life. Mastery of cooking approaches such as tempering, sautéing, and slow-cooking is essential. Solidifying, or "tadka," includes heating oil and adding flavors to release their necessary oils, creating a savory base. Sautéing allows vegetables to maintain their texture while taking in spices. Slow-cooking, or "dum," blends flavors gradually, enhancing the meal's complexity. Various other techniques like grinding flavors fresh and using yogurt as a marinate add to the cuisine's deepness. Additionally, the art of layering flavors via different cooking phases showcases the complexities of Indian vegan food preparation, elevating the eating experience to an aromatic event of preference and custom.
